Update itoa and dirs (#1601)

This commit is contained in:
Paolo Barbolini
2021-12-29 20:56:58 +01:00
committed by GitHub
parent beb2100f29
commit fca866d0bc
5 changed files with 17 additions and 11 deletions

View File

@@ -115,7 +115,7 @@ crossbeam-queue = "0.3.1"
crossbeam-channel = "0.5.0"
crossbeam-utils = { version = "0.8.1", default-features = false }
digest = { version = "0.9.0", default-features = false, optional = true, features = ["std"] }
dirs = { version = "3.0.1", optional = true }
dirs = { version = "4", optional = true }
encoding_rs = { version = "0.8.23", optional = true }
either = "1.5.3"
futures-channel = { version = "0.3.5", default-features = false, features = ["sink", "alloc", "std"] }
@@ -125,7 +125,7 @@ futures-util = { version = "0.3.5", default-features = false, features = ["alloc
generic-array = { version = "0.14.4", default-features = false, optional = true }
hex = "0.4.2"
hmac = { version = "0.11.0", default-features = false, optional = true }
itoa = "0.4.5"
itoa = "1"
ipnetwork = { version = "0.17.0", default-features = false, optional = true }
mac_address = { version = "1.1", default-features = false, optional = true }
libc = "0.2.71"

View File

@@ -72,7 +72,7 @@ impl MssqlArguments {
self.name.push_str("@p");
self.ordinal += 1;
let _ = itoa::fmt(&mut self.name, self.ordinal);
self.name.push_str(itoa::Buffer::new().format(self.ordinal));
let MssqlArguments {
ref name,

View File

@@ -567,7 +567,7 @@ impl TypeInfo {
// size
if self.size < 8000 && self.size > 0 {
s.push_str("(");
let _ = itoa::fmt(&mut *s, self.size);
s.push_str(itoa::Buffer::new().format(self.size));
s.push_str(")");
} else {
s.push_str("(max)");

View File

@@ -33,7 +33,7 @@ impl PgBufMutExt for Vec<u8> {
// N.B. if you change this don't forget to update it in ../describe.rs
self.extend(b"sqlx_s_");
itoa::write(&mut *self, id).unwrap();
self.extend(itoa::Buffer::new().format(id).as_bytes());
self.push(0);
}
@@ -44,7 +44,7 @@ impl PgBufMutExt for Vec<u8> {
if let Some(id) = id {
self.extend(b"sqlx_p_");
itoa::write(&mut *self, id).unwrap();
self.extend(itoa::Buffer::new().format(id).as_bytes());
}
self.push(0);